当前位置: 首页 > news >正文

TCP/UDP调试工具推荐:Socket通信图解教程

TCP/UDP调试工具推荐:Socket通信图解教程

  • 一、引言
  • 二、串口调试流程
  • 三、下载链接

SocketTool 调试助手是一款旨在协助程序员和网络管理员进行TCP和UDP协议调试的网络通信工具。TCP作为一种面向连接、可靠的协议,具有诸如连接管理、数据分片与重组、流量和拥塞控制等特点。该工具支持TCP Server和TCP Client两种模式,允许用户模拟服务器和客户端进行通信测试。

一、引言

串口调试(Serial Port Debugging)在硬件开发和软件调试过程中具有极其重要的意义。以下是串口调试的一些主要意义:

1、实时数据通信:
串口通信是一种简单且可靠的数据传输方式,常用于微控制器、计算机和其他设备之间的数据交换。通过串口调试,开发者可以实时查看和发送数据,这对于调试和验证硬件与软件之间的通信非常关键。
2、故障排查:
在硬件或软件开发过程中,串口调试提供了一种快速定位问题的方法。通过观察串口输出的日志信息,开发者可以迅速识别并解决通信故障、数据错误或程序异常等问题。
3、硬件验证:
串口调试可用于验证硬件设计的正确性。通过发送和接收特定格式的数据包,开发者可以测试硬件接口的性能和稳定性,确保硬件设计满足预期要求。

串口调试在硬件开发和软件调试过程中发挥着不可或缺的作用。它不仅提供了实时数据通信和故障排查的手段,还支持设备配置、软件开发、硬件验证和跨平台兼容性测试等多个方面。

二、串口调试流程

1.打开SocketTool 软件。软件下载链接 提取码:ke5r
在这里插入图片描述
2.打开需要调试的软件通讯模块。
在这里插入图片描述
3.为让调试助手连接软件,需要获取到服务端IP。通过输入win+r,再输入cmd
在这里插入图片描述
再输入:ipconfig 查看ip
在这里插入图片描述
4.第四步,Socket调试工具作为客户端,新建TCP Client,输入对方的IP和端口号,点击连接即可。
在这里插入图片描述
在图中的软件,连接成功后,右下角会显示客户端已连接。
在这里插入图片描述
5.第五步,通信测试。通过在调试助手发送相关指令,判断待调试软件是否接收,并且返回指令。
下图是调试工具显示的数据传输信息
在这里插入图片描述
下图是测试软件显示的数据传输信息
在这里插入图片描述
这款TCP-UDP-Socket调试工具,用来模拟真实项目中的数据通信非常方便好用,轻量化的设计让它更加灵活高效,功能也非常全面。

三、下载链接

Socket调试工具下载
提取码:ke5r

相关文章:

  • vscode settings(二):文件资源管理器编辑功能主题快捷键
  • 字符串中字母的大小写转换
  • 【模板】Linux中cmake使用编译c++程序
  • 【JavaEE进阶】Spring DI
  • 基于Springboot银行信用卡额度管理系统【附源码】
  • 学术论文翻译
  • 俄罗斯方块
  • 多线程群聊服务器设计
  • 500字理透react的hook闭包问题
  • RPC 框架项目剖析
  • 网络和操作系统基础篇
  • Python pip 缓存清理:全面方法与操作指南
  • 【算法通关村 Day9】二分查找与二叉树的中序遍历
  • 人工智能_大模型092_超简单_win10中安装deepseek_效果非常好_亲测_带RGA功能_桌面版---人工智能工作笔记0237
  • 【2025全网首发B站教程】YOLOv12训练数据集构建:标签格式转换-划分-YAML 配置 避坑指南 | 小白也能轻松玩转目标检测!
  • [oAuth2授权]Web前端+NodeCoze API Web后端程序+Coze授权服务器工作流程架构流程图详解
  • 在Ubuntu下通过Docker部署Nginx服务器
  • 6. Go接口
  • C++双指针:算法优化的“左右互搏术”与高效问题破解全指南
  • 蓝桥杯备赛-基础训练(三)哈希表 day16
  • 央行4月开展12000亿元买断式逆回购操作
  • 稳就业稳经济五方面若干举措将成熟一项出台一项
  • 这场迪图瓦纪念拉威尔的音乐会,必将成为乐迷反复品味的回忆
  • 2025厦门体育产业采风活动圆满举行
  • 俄罗斯称已收复库尔斯克州,普京发表讲话
  • 江苏、安徽跨省联动共治“样板间”:进一扇门可办两省事